The Role

As a Maintenance Engineer, your responsibilities include, but are not limited to:

• Working with industrial mechanical equipment and components such as valves, bearings, shafts, rollers, hydraulics etc.

• Fault finding electrically on sensors, relays, inverters, VFD's, three phase motors etc.

• Getting stuck in with different Continuous Improvement Projects

• Working with a team on large industrial pumps, separators etc.

• Performing Reactive and Planned Preventative Maintenance

About You

The ideal Maintenance Engineer will have the following:

• A recognised engineering qualification

• Experience working with a maintenance engineering team

• A sound understanding of key mechanical components

• Previous hydraulic experience is beneficial, though not essential
